Technical field
The utility model relates to Tool monitoring equipment technical field, specially it is a kind of can multi-directional rotation clamping device.
Background technique
With the development of economy, manufacturing industry industry also constantly improves, especially in machining accuracy, more finely.Cause And the requirement for cutter also seems more stringent, the depth of parallelism needed for cutter clamping, verticality and cutter various sizes essence Degree, requires accurately to detect.It is not only merely one that often a cutter, which needs the data detected, in the detection, for difference Position, different angles requires to measure.If measuring other positions, cutter if, needs clamping again, leads to a cutter Detection it is time-consuming and laborious on clamping.How to allow detection more convenient, simply, the design of the clamping device of detection seems outstanding It is important.
All there is the clampings for mostly using single direction for the clamping tool largely detected at present, are unable to satisfy a variety of need It asks, when making troubles to Tool monitoring work, and adjusting every time, requires to unscrew fixture again, be clamped again after adjustment, drag slow Work rhythm, while the shortcomings that cannot achieve the measurement of multiple directions, seriously affect the efficiency of detection.

Iron ball 5: being fitted into bottom plate 1 by working principle first, then puts rubber pad 7, covers top panel 10 and with standard pin 17 and bolt 16 it is fixed, complete the fixation of iron ball 5 in a device, then screw thread swing rod 14 is threaded on iron ball 5, then will be strong Magnetic magnet 18 is put into the swing rod on 14 top of screw thread swing rod in the hollow cylinder body on 15, completing screw thread swing rod 14 in a device Connection, after device installs, will test sample and is put on strong magnetic magnet 18, the data demand which detects as needed can Realize multi-directional rotation and the adjustment in swing rod direction, in the apparatus, bottom plate 1 plays fixed iron ball 5, the effect of substrate is formed, Iron ball 5 plays multi-directional rotation, and rubber pad 7 plays the role of generating flexible fastening to steel ball;Top panel 10 plays stationary balls, shape Play connection and fine tuning at the effect screw thread swing rod 14 of pedestal, bolt 16 plays the role of fastening, and standard pin 17 guarantees pedestal Verticality, strong magnetic magnet 18 play the role of placing detection sample.
